Nikil Viswanathan
Tech entrepreneur and co-founder of Alchemy
Nikil Viswanathan is a prominent entrepreneur, best known as the co-founder and CEO of Alchemy, a leading blockchain developer platform. Under his leadership, Alchemy has rapidly grown to become a significant player in the Web3 space, achieving a valuation of over $10 billion within just 16 months of its public launch. The platform is responsible for powering over $100 billion in transactions globally, including a substantial portion of the NFT industry and various top blockchain companies.123
Education and Early Career
Viswanathan earned both his Bachelor’s and Master’s degrees in Computer Science from Stanford University, where he focused on artificial intelligence. His early career included product management roles at major tech companies such as Google, Microsoft, and Facebook. He also co-created the social app "Down To Lunch," which became the #1 social app in the App Store and was featured in major media outlets like The New York Times.1256
Achievements and Recognition
Nikil has been recognized in Forbes' "30 Under 30" list for his contributions to technology and entrepreneurship. His work at Alchemy has not only garnered significant financial backing from notable investors but has also positioned the company as a critical infrastructure provider for developers in the blockchain ecosystem.1234
Vision for Alchemy
Viswanathan's vision for Alchemy extends beyond mere financial success; he aims to onboard a billion people to Web3, emphasizing the transformative potential of decentralized technologies in various sectors, particularly in regions with unstable currencies. He believes that blockchain can provide significant benefits to underserved communities by offering access to decentralized finance solutions.45
